Apple rejected Elon Mask's satellite proposal, now his plans are at risk: report

Apple offers a satellite connection to the iPhone since 2022 and has expanded the services since then. But in accordance with the new report from information, Apple’s ambitions were once much more and there were delays in fears related to partnerships, the federal government and even Elon Musk. Ambitions

Aaron Tilley and Wayne Ma Write at the Information:

Starting in 2015, Apple and Boeing Held Early Discussions ABOUT ATELLITEITERNET PROJECT that WOLD InVOLVE DELIVERING Full-Blown Wireless Internet Service, Not Just Emergency Communications Services, To iPhones and at home, according to five people involved in the project or informed about the project. For home users, Apple planned to offer antennas that people could adhere to their windows to scatter their Internet connection throughout the building. […]

But in the end, Apple became cold legs. Tim Cook, the general director of Apple, was concerned that the project would jeopardize the company's relationship with the telecommunications industry, said that people with direct knowledge about the project. The company prevented the company to continue full-scale satellite offers, which she once assumed.

According to the report, Mask approached Apple in 2022 with a proposal, having heard that the company plans to announce about Satellite function with the iPhone 14. Two people with direct knowledge of the transaction. According to people, after this exclusivity period, MUSK offered the Apple Pay SpaceX $ 1 billion a year for Starlink. In addition, if Apple could not reconcile with SpaceX, Musk threatened to announce a similar satellite function that could work with the iPhone, people added. He gave Apple 72 hours to decide.

Apple rejected the offer from Musk, which later coped with its threat. Two weeks before the iPhone 14 was announced, SpaceX announced a partnership with T-Mobile phones in August 2022, which allowed users of smartphones to send and receive text messages in areas without reception using Starlink.
